About the role

Own the tutor pipeline end-to-endsourcing, screening, interviews, reference checks, onboarding & compliance, and database hygiene. You know what a great tutor looks like (AU education context), keep a healthy bench by subject/city, and move quickly. Occasional training/check-ins for tutors is a nice-to-have, but your core is hiring + readiness + matching support. This is a part-time role (1520 hrs/week) with scope to scale.

What you'll do

  • Source quality talent at volume: LinkedIn Recruiter (HubSpot & Dripify, Boolean, projects, InMail), Indeed/Seek/FB groups/referrals.
  • Screen & interview: structured rubrics + short work samples; run reference/WWCC checks.
  • Onboard placement-ready within 72h
  • Maintain the bench: up-to-date availability for tutors; ready tutors per high-demand subject/areas.
  • Match support: have an excellent eye for which tutor will be best for which student
  • Offboard well: collect feedback, update records, protect standards.
  • Tighten ops: keep SOPs, saved replies/templates, and tracking sheets tidy; suggest improvements in software such as ClickUp/HubSpot/Teachworks.
  • Report weekly metrics: bench health, time-to-shortlist, acceptance %, reply SLAs, compliance.

Must-have skills

  • Tutor recruiting experience in a tutoring or education company (AU/UK/US).
  • LinkedIn Recruiter power user (HubSpot & Dripify, Boolean strings, projects, InMail, pipelines).
  • Structured interviewing & evidence-based hiring decisions.
  • Strong communication skills; crisp written comms; detail-obsessed.
  • Ops discipline (SLAs, shared inboxes, clean data).
  • Tools: LinkedIn Recruiter & Indeed (required); Google Workspace; ClickUp/HubSpot, Dripify, Calendly, nice-to-have.
  • AEST overlap

Nice-to-have

  • AU curriculum familiarity (NSW/VIC; HSC/NAPLAN).
  • Running tutor webinars/PD and/or doing coaching/check-ins.

Employment type: Part-time (contract), 1520 hrs/week, with path to full-time based on results.

Compensation: Please include your monthly rate (assuming 80hrs/ month).
